GOOBER PEAS 
3-4 tbsp. oil
1 sm. onion, chopped
1 sm. bell pepper, chopped
2 (16 oz.) cans fresh shelled black-eyed peas
1 (14 1/2 oz.) can tomatoes, cut up
Salt & pepper to taste
Hot cooked rice
Cornbread

In a saucepan heat the oil and saute the onion and bell pepper until soft and the onion is slightly brown. Add the black-eyed peas. Cut the tomatoes up and add to the mixture and season to taste. Cook uncovered over low heat for about 30-40 minutes, until the flavors are well blended but the liquid is not cooked down too much. Serve over hot white rice with cornbread.

Variation: Fry 1/2 to 1 pound of crumbled pork sausage with the onion before adding the other ingredients. Serves 1 Goober or 4 ordinary eaters.
